Unmatched Heat and UV Rejection

One of the primary reasons to choose 3M window films for your property is their exceptional ability to block heat and UV rays. These films are designed to reject up to 97% of heat-producing infrared rays and up to 99% of damaging UV rays, ensuring your spaces remain cool and protected from sun damage. This is crucial in Houston’s climate, where the sun can lead to increased cooling costs and fading of interior furnishings [source].

Significant Energy Savings

Installing 3M window films is not just about comfort; it’s also a smart financial decision. The energy savings provided by these films are substantial, often leading to a return on investment in less than three years. For many properties, utility rebates may accelerate this payback period to as short as one year, making it an economically wise choice [source].

Durability and Safety

These window films are not only energy-efficient but also enhance the safety and security of your glass installations. They hold glass fragments together upon impact, whether by natural disasters or human causes, thereby reducing the risk of injury and property damage. This safety feature is especially valuable in areas prone to severe weather conditions like Houston.
